Output 5418696c44a655d16c12202fad8c5905ba0889d8a4978a2796da6d1d54d046e2:1

value
156563658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75cb5a7bd30ab1a76d59e70dd8672db43c8ed062 OP_EQUAL
address
3CRrbEVbKd6dVJEqNP6j2x9CC4uSfubfCS
transaction
5418696c44a655d16c12202fad8c5905ba0889d8a4978a2796da6d1d54d046e2
spent
true